Six features that matter to legal operations and pricing

Detailed capability highlights that influence adoption, staffing, and long-term cost when choosing an eSignature solution paired with CRM.

Template Conditional Logic

Conditional fields allow documents to adapt to case facts, minimizing manual edits and reducing the number of templates needed across practice areas.

Bulk Send

Sending identical documents to many recipients in one job reduces manual sends and administrative time for firm-wide notices and routine filings.

Advanced Authentication

Options such as SMS and knowledge-based verification increase confidence in signer identity where evidentiary standards are higher.

Audit Trail Export

Exportable, tamper-evident logs enable easy inclusion of execution evidence in discovery or retention systems.

API and Webhooks

Real-time synchronization with CRM or case management reduces duplication and supports automated matter lifecycle events.

Role-Based Access

Granular permissions protect privileged documents and restrict template editing to authorized staff.

Operational best practices for legal eSignatures

Practical guidelines to maintain secure, auditable, and efficient signing workflows in a law firm environment.

Standardize templates and naming conventions
Use a controlled template library with consistent naming and version control so attorneys and staff always use the correct form, reducing signature errors and retention gaps.
Enforce role-based access and approvals
Limit template creation and signature finalization to designated roles, require secondary approvals for high-risk documents, and log actions for audit purposes to maintain chain-of-custody.
Document authentication policy
Define when to require SMS or knowledge-based authentication for client signatures, balancing ease of use against evidentiary needs in dispute scenarios involving contract enforceability.
Retain executed copies and metadata
Implement retention rules that archive signed files with complete metadata and audit trails to meet discovery obligations and regulatory retention schedules.
